Process crash via unchecked packet-buffer offset
Published Aug 18, 2022 · Updated Aug 3, 2024
Heap-based buffer overflow in Tcpreplay 4.4.1 allows attackers to crash tcprewrite by supplying a crafted packet-capture file. get_l2len_protocol accepts a capture length equal to the computed Layer 2 network offset, then reads pktdata[l2_net_off] one byte beyond the heap buffer. Processing the malicious capture is required; the public reproduction establishes a process crash but does not establish code execution.
